A restaurant franchise is making its way to the Tri-Cities.
First Watch, known as a daytime cafe, has plans to open locations in Bristol, Kingsport and Johnson City, along with Knoxville and Asheville, North Carolina during the next five years.
The first one is expected to open in the first half of this year in Knoxville.
Each of the restaurants are expected to employ about 25 people.
First Watch is open seven days a week from seven in the morning to 2:30 in the afternoon.
It offers free newspapers and wifi internet access.
